It could be so much better!
The greek restaurant "Artemis Speise" is in the centre of Essen, 10 minutes on foot from the main train station.It is easy to find it.Just ask where Gänsemarkt 44 (45127 Essen) is.
A friendly person will welcome you for sure at the entrance of the restaurant. Most of the times it is full, so maybe you will have to wait a bit at the bar. After a while the waiter will come and lead you to the first available table.
The decoration is so old fashioned! People used to decorate their restaurants like that in the 70s.Ok I am myself greek and I understand the need of the owner to promote the greek culture and the greek spirit, but not like that!!!!!!
Durind your lunch/dinner in Artemis you are surrounded from statues in all kind of sizes watching you...as if they want to ask if your dinner was good enough or not.
And what is that with the PLASTIC FLOWERS everywhere!!!!? Mama mia!
As far as the food is concerned I have nothing negativ to remember.The quality and the quantity was really good.The only I have to claim- always as a greek- is the fact that the menu is quite germanised (made in this way,so that it can fit better to the german food preferences).
The prices are ok.Not expensive but not cheap either.
It is worthy to visit Artemis Speise restaurant if you are into greek kitchen and if you find yourself in Essen.
Just a last suggestion: Order the "Musaka" dish and you will not regret it!
Enjoy your meal! Kali oreksi (in greek )
